Advertisement
Guest User

Untitled

a guest
Nov 11th, 2013
62
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.19 KB | None | 0 0
  1. replaceafill@system76:~/dev/sandboxes/fixes/schooltool.gradebook$ bzr diff
  2. === modified file 'src/schooltool/gradebook/stesting.py'
  3. --- src/schooltool/gradebook/stesting.py 2013-10-06 21:20:12 +0000
  4. +++ src/schooltool/gradebook/stesting.py 2013-11-08 20:54:25 +0000
  5. @@ -33,7 +33,7 @@
  6. result = []
  7. sel = 'ul.third-nav li'
  8. for tab in browser.query_all.css(sel):
  9. - text = tab.text.strip()
  10. + text = tab.query.tag('a').get_attribute('title').strip()
  11. css_class = tab.get_attribute('class')
  12. if css_class is not None and 'active' in css_class:
  13. text = '*%s*' % text
  14. @@ -159,7 +159,10 @@
  15. '//tbody/tr[%s]/td[%s]' % (row_index+1, column_index+1))
  16. cell = browser.query.xpath(sel)
  17. cell.click()
  18. - cell.query.tag('input').type(browser.keys.DELETE, grade, browser.keys.ENTER, browser.keys.UP)
  19. + cell.query.tag('input').type(browser.keys.DELETE, grade)
  20. + sel = 'ul.ui-autocomplete'
  21. + browser.driver.execute_script(
  22. + '$(arguments[0]).find(arguments[1]).hide()', cell, sel)
  23.  
  24. registry.register('SeleniumHelpers',
  25. lambda: schooltool.testing.selenium.registerBrowserUI(
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ement